what environmental factors can change the rate of water uptake in plants?

A
  • light intensity
  • air movement
  • temperature

what is a potometer used for?

A

for measuring the rate of transpiration

what is the first step of calculating the rate of transpiration using a potometer?

A
  1. note the position of the air bubble on the capillary tube (ruler)

what is the second step of calculating the rate of transpiration using a potometer?

A
  1. note the position of the bubble on the ruler after a known amount of minuets

what is the final step of calculating the rate of transpiration using a potometer?

A

divide the distance moved by the bubble by the time taken

what is the equation for the rate of transpiration?

A

distance moved / time taken
